If the amount of cerebral hemorrhage is small and the bleeding site is in the basal ganglia area, it can be discharged in two to three weeks; if the amount of bleeding is large and the symptoms are more serious, surgery is required, and the length of hospitalization will be correspondingly prolonged, generally more than one month.
